    Exactly which english channels can you get with the satelite? Also, can you get other countries' channels?


  • Closed Accounts Posts: 88,978 ✭✭✭✭mike65


    You can get everything that is not tied to an exclusive SKY contract which is most channels you'd probably want to watch as it happens.

    BBC1, 2, 3, 4, cbbc, cbeebies, ITV1, 2, 3, 4, Channel 4, E4, More 4, Film Four, Channel 5, 5USA 5* and the +1s Horror Channel, True Movies 1 & 2, Movies For Men 1 & 2, Sky News, BBC News, CCN, CNBC, Euronews, Aj Jezza, Russia Today, Chinese news (x2) various music channels but not any MTVs/VH1s.

    Full list here http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_free-to-air_channels_at_28°E
